The Consumer Price Index in Fiji decreased 1.40 percent in August of 2025 over the previous month, after a 0.5 percent fall in July, marking the steepest decline since March 2021. Inflation Rate MoM in Fiji averaged 0.15 percent from 2013 until 2025, reaching an all time high of 2.30 percent in January of 2017 and a record low of -2.60 percent in March of 2021. source: Fiji Bureau of Statistics
